Promising signs of growth within the services sector
Mark Simsey-Durrant, Chief Executive Officer at Hampshire Trust Bank, responds to the rise seen in today’s Markit Services PMI:
“Today’s rise shows there are some promising signs of growth in the services sector. Businesses are facing a number of challenges due to the current environment of economic and political uncertainty. Often firms look to scale back in times such as these. However, we believe this is not a long-term trend and the fact the PMI is above 50 indicates there is growth within the sector. We urge all types of businesses to not lose confidence and continue to invest for growth in the second half of the year.”
